Melanotan 2 Peptide (MT-2) – Synthetic Melanocortin Research Peptide
Melanotan 2 (MT-2) is a synthetic peptide analog of alpha-melanocyte-stimulating hormone (α-MSH), widely studied for its interaction with melanocortin receptors involved in pigmentation and biological signaling pathways. Due to its stability and receptor affinity, Melanotan 2 has become a well-known compound in peptide and melanocortin research.
What Is Melanotan 2?
elanotan 2 peptide is a cyclic peptide designed to mimic the activity of naturally occurring melanocortins. It is primarily researched for its role in melanin production pathways and receptor binding behavior within the melanocortin system.

Important specifications
| Feature | Value / explanation |
|---|---|
| Name | Melanotan 2 Peptide |
| Molecular formula | C50H69N15O9 |
| Molecular weight | ≈ 1024.18 Da |
| Form | Lyophilisate (dry powder) |
| Purity | ≥ 99 % (HPLC tested) |
| Storage conditions | Store refrigerated, protected from light and moisture. |
